About The Author
Rachelle Robinett
Rachelle Robinett is a clinical herbalist, writer, educator and life-long naturalist. She is the founder and CEO of Pharmakon Supernatural, a multidisciplinary brand dedicated to the art and science of natural health. Combining traditional medicine and current health insights with an understanding of individual behaviour modification, Rachelle offers accessible plant-based healing through private coaching, teaching and consulting. She’s based in New York City.
